The Impact of Rubber Fuel Pipes on Automotive Performance and Safety Introduction Automotive fuel systems are critical components that ensure the smooth and efficient operation of vehicles. One of the key components in these systems is the fuel pipe, which transports fuel from the fuel tank to the engine. Over time, rubber fuel pipes can degrade due to exposure to various environmental factors, such as heat, ozone, and chemicals. This degradation can lead to a range of issues, including reduced performance and increased safety risks. In this article, we will discuss the impact of rubber fuel pipes on automotive performance and safety, as well as the benefits of using alternative materials for these applications. Impact on Performance One of the primary concerns with degraded rubber fuel pipes is their effect on vehicle performance. As the rubber deteriorates, it becomes more brittle and prone to cracking. This can result in leaks, which can reduce the amount of fuel reaching the engine, leading to decreased performance and increased fuel consumption. In severe cases, leaks can cause the engine to stall or even stop running altogether, causing inconvenience and potential safety hazards. Impact on Safety In addition to performance issues, degraded rubber fuel pipes can also pose significant safety risks. This can lead to a fire or explosion, which can cause serious injury or even death. Furthermore, if a leak occurs while the vehicle is being driven, it can cause the driver to lose control of the vehicle, leading to a crash. Benefits of Alternative Materials Fortunately, there are alternative materials that can be used to replace rubber fuel pipes in modern vehicles. One such material is polyamide, which is known for its high strength, durability, and resistance to chemicals and heat. Polyamide fuel pipes are also less prone to cracking and leaks than rubber pipes, making them a safer and more reliable option. Another alternative material is polyethylene, which has similar properties to polyamide but is slightly lighter in weight. Conclusion In conclusion, rubber fuel pipes can have a significant impact on automotive performance and safety due to their susceptibility to degradation. However, by using alternative materials such as polyamide and polyethylene, manufacturers can create more durable and reliable fuel systems that provide better performance and protection against safety hazards. As the demand for safer and more efficient vehicles continues to grow, it is essential that automotive manufacturers consider the use of alternative materials in their fuel systems to ensure the safety and reliability of their products.
